Web11 sep. 2024 · The U.S. tops the current list, with 30 completed successful missions to the moon or its orbit between 1959 and 2013, according to OMG Space. The USSR flew 23 such missions between 1959 and 1976. China stepped up its space program in the 2000s and flew its first mission of the Chang’e program in 2007. Web12 jan. 2012 · The Moon is our hammer. Perhaps the most important effect of the Moon is the way it stabilizes our rotation. When the Earth rotates it wobbles slightly back and forth on its axis. It’s like a top, which doesn’t simply spin in a vertical position on a table or the floor. But without the Moon we’d be wobbling much more. Web16 jul. 2024 · The United States would go on to complete six crewed missions to the moon that landed a total of 12 astronauts (all men) from 1969 to 1972 in a series of Apollo missions numbering up to Apollo 17. WebTwelve people have walked on Earth's Moon, the first one was Neil Armstrong and the last one was Gene Cernan.
